The Core Factors Driving the 12V 100Ah Lithium-Ion Battery Price
Cell Chemistry & Quality: The Heart of the Matter
Not all lithium is created equal. The safest and most durable chemistry for stationary and mobile storage is Lithium Iron Phosphate (LiFePO4 or LFP).
- Grade A vs. Grade B/C Cells: Premium manufacturers use Grade A cells, which meet strict specifications for capacity, internal resistance, and longevity. Lower-cost options may use lower-grade cells with inconsistent performance and a higher failure rate. This is one of the most significant hidden cost drivers.
- Energy Density: Higher-quality cells with better energy density often command a higher price but contribute to a more compact and efficient pack.
The Brain: Battery Management System (BMS)
The BMS is the unsung hero. A sophisticated BMS does far more than prevent overcharge and over-discharge.
| BMS Capability | Basic Battery | Premium Battery (e.g., Highjoule) |
|---|---|---|
| Cell Balancing | Passive (resistor-based) | Active balancing (extends cycle life) |
| Communication | None or basic LED | Bluetooth/RS485 for real-time monitoring (voltage, temp, SOC) |
| Temperature Management | Basic cutoff | Heating & cooling integration for full-temperature range operation |
| Protection Features | Standard | Advanced (short-circuit, surge, isolation monitoring) |
Investing in a smart BMS means investing in the battery's intelligence and your own peace of mind.

Making an Informed Decision: Your Checklist
Before you decide based on the listed price, ask these questions:
- Chemistry: Is it LiFePO4 for safety and cycle life?
- BMS Intelligence: Does it offer active balancing, temperature management, and monitoring?
- Warranty & Support: Is the warranty long, clear, and backed by a company with a proven track record?
- Certifications: Does it have necessary safety certifications (UL, CE, UN38.3) for your region?
- Scalability: Can you easily add more batteries in parallel for future needs?
